Diabetic retinopathy (DR) is a condition that infects the eyes that involve people with diabetes losing their vision. It influences the blood vessels of the eye. Sometimes people complain about eyesight problems, such as difficulties reading or seeing too far away. The retina's blood vessels begin to bleed in the later disease later stages. Highly trained experts typically examine coloured fundus images to detect this fatal condition. This condition's manual diagnosis is time-consuming and error-prone. As a result, many computers vision-based algorithms for automatically detecting DR and its various stages from retina images have been presented. We used the Kaggle retina image dataset for this study, which is openly accessible. We introduced a convolutional neural network (CNN), and long short-term memory (LSTM) based deep learning technique for diagnosing diabetic retinopathy. The system attains better …
